Add 30/10 and 64/9
1st number: 3 0/10, 2nd number: 7 1/9
30/10 + 64/9 is 91/9.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 10 and 9 is 90
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 90 - For the 1st fraction, since 10 × 9 = 90,
30/10 = 30 × 9/10 × 9 = 270/90 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 9 × 10 = 90,
64/9 = 64 × 10/9 × 10 = 640/90 - Add the two like fractions:
270/90 + 640/90 = 270 + 640/90 = 910/90 - 910/90 simplified gives 91/9
- So, 30/10 + 64/9 = 91/9
